Pregnancy assistance
Tuesday, June 17, 1997 | 11:59 a.m.
LIFE LINE FAMILY EDUCATION CENTER, 1800 Industrial Road, 871-6585. Programs include parenting classes, such as "First Time Fathers"; the For Women Only support group; emergency food, shelter, clothing and baby supplies; free pregnancy tests; 24-hour hotline (477-6435); on-site child-care; GED program; and adoption referrals
HUNTRIDGE TEEN CLINIC, 2100 S. Maryland Parkway, 732-8776 Provides health care for teens 11-19, prescribes birth control, offers free pregnancy testing and counseling.
CRISIS PREGNANCY CENTER, 721 E. Charleston Blvd., Suite 6, 366-1247. It offers counseling, referrals, free pregnancy tests, maternity/baby clothing, diapers, food, "Computer Moms" group and a continuing education program.
